/*
- * These get/set macros do not handle mis-aligned data.
- * The data are all supposed to be aligned, but that's
- * up to the server. If we ever encounter a server that
- * doesn't obey this rule, a "strict alignment" client
- * (i.e. SPARC) may get an alignment trap in one of these.
- * If that ever happens, make these macros into functions
- * that can handle mis-aligned data. (Or catch traps.)
- */
-#define getb(buf, ofs) (((const uint8_t *)(buf))[ofs])
-#define setb(buf, ofs, val) (((uint8_t *)(buf))[ofs]) = val
-#define getbw(buf, ofs) ((uint16_t)(getb(buf, ofs)))
-#define getw(buf, ofs) (*((uint16_t *)(&((uint8_t *)(buf))[ofs])))
-#define getdw(buf, ofs) (*((uint32_t *)(&((uint8_t *)(buf))[ofs])))
-
-#ifdef _LITTLE_ENDIAN
-
-#define getwle(buf, ofs) (*((uint16_t *)(&((uint8_t *)(buf))[ofs])))
-#define getdle(buf, ofs) (*((uint32_t *)(&((uint8_t *)(buf))[ofs])))
-#define getwbe(buf, ofs) (ntohs(getwle(buf, ofs)))
-#define getdbe(buf, ofs) (ntohl(getdle(buf, ofs)))
-
-#define setwle(buf, ofs, val) getwle(buf, ofs) = val
-#define setwbe(buf, ofs, val) getwle(buf, ofs) = htons(val)
-#define setdle(buf, ofs, val) getdle(buf, ofs) = val
-#define setdbe(buf, ofs, val) getdle(buf, ofs) = htonl(val)
-
-#else /* _LITTLE_ENDIAN */
-
-#define getwbe(buf, ofs) (*((uint16_t *)(&((uint8_t *)(buf))[ofs])))
-#define getdbe(buf, ofs) (*((uint32_t *)(&((uint8_t *)(buf))[ofs])))
-#define getwle(buf, ofs) (BSWAP_16(getwbe(buf, ofs)))
-#define getdle(buf, ofs) (BSWAP_32(getdbe(buf, ofs)))
-
-#define setwbe(buf, ofs, val) getwbe(buf, ofs) = val
-#define setwle(buf, ofs, val) getwbe(buf, ofs) = BSWAP_16(val)
-#define setdbe(buf, ofs, val) getdbe(buf, ofs) = val
-#define setdle(buf, ofs, val) getdbe(buf, ofs) = BSWAP_32(val)
-
-#endif /* _LITTLE_ENDIAN */
